Output 15a4e1857f31c83b7441f40a901b8077ec502aea183682867f39bdbcaa54a36d:0

value
18937500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87f7ea4020756cd728c09812c23581e228785022 OP_EQUAL
address
3E5x8szCz58twHTf2jdahH6toQiV5xn58w
transaction
15a4e1857f31c83b7441f40a901b8077ec502aea183682867f39bdbcaa54a36d
spent
true